Transaction 3be87909208a7a9363bda20f86beb1819ac93d0052d3dcc429a1fd9dc0d2fbbd

block
c6b72bee1c7d6d7505ce8488b6e9aa3dcab1ad5cef90d438e8733651ed51029a

1 Input

23 Outputs